This service is available for all pregnant women, children, families and young people in Milton Keynes. All services are provided within the integrated 0-19 team and include Health Visiting and School Nursing. Aiming to help to empower parents, children and young people to make decisions that affect their and their family’s health, development and wellbeing.
Staff consist of health visitors, school nurses, staff nurses, nursery nurses, healthcare assistants and administrators. Health visitors and school nurses are all qualified nurses or midwives who have undertaken specialist training in public health, child development and health needs assessment.
